Property Description

Luxurious 5-Star Experience

The Marine Hotel stands as a majestic 5-star property with breathtaking views of the Firth of Clyde and the Isle of Arran. Overlooking the prestigious Royal Troon Golf Course, this grand building offers a range of top-notch amenities for a truly luxurious stay.

Wellness and Relaxation

Indulge in the fitness facilities, sauna, spa bath, steam room, indoor pool, and beauty salon available on-site. Unwind and rejuvenate in style during your stay at the Marine Hotel.

Gastronomic Delights and Nearby Attractions

Savor delectable meals at the hotel's restaurant or enjoy snacks and drinks at the bar. Explore nearby attractions such as Culzean Castle and Country Park, and the plethora of golf courses in the area. With Glasgow and Ayr just a short drive away, the Marine Hotel offers the perfect blend of luxury and convenience.

Property Policies

  • Parking

    Free private parking is possible on site (reservation is not needed).

  • Groups

    When booking more than 5 rooms, different policies and additional supplements may apply.

  • Internet

    WiFi is available in all areas and is free of charge.

  • Pets

    Pets are allowed. Charges may be applicable.

  • Children and extra bed policy

    Children of any age are allowed.
    Children up to and including 2 years old stay for free when using an available cot.
    Children up to and including 12 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
    Children from 3 years old to 12 years old stay for £30 per person per night when using an available extra bed.
    People 13 years old and over stay for £75 per person per night when using an available extra bed.
    Any type of extra bed or child's cot/crib is upon request and needs to be confirmed by management.
    Supplements are not calculated automatically in the total costs and will have to be paid for separately during your stay.
